Understanding Carotid Artery Anatomy

Before delving into the effects of being born without a carotid artery, it is important to understand the normal anatomy of the carotid artery and its role in cardiovascular health. The carotid artery is a major blood vessel located in the neck that supplies oxygenated blood to the brain, face, and neck region. It is divided into two main branches, the common carotid artery and the internal carotid artery.

The common carotid artery is responsible for supplying blood to the head and neck, dividing into the internal and external carotid arteries. The internal carotid artery is essential for supplying blood to the brain, while the external carotid artery provides blood to the face, scalp, and neck muscles.

The carotid artery anatomy plays a crucial role in maintaining cardiovascular health. Any deviations or abnormalities in this anatomy can lead to cardiovascular abnormalities and vascular anomalies. These structural variations can impact blood flow, blood pressure regulation, and may contribute to the development of cardiovascular conditions.

What is Carotid Artery Agenesis?

Carotid artery agenesis is a rare medical condition characterized by the absence or non-development of the carotid artery. The carotid artery plays a crucial role in supplying oxygenated blood to the head and neck. When this blood vessel is missing, it can lead to significant cardiovascular implications and associated congenital vascular malformations.

Although carotid artery agenesis is a rare condition, its prevalence is not well-documented due to its rarity and often asymptomatic nature. However, it is believed to be a congenital abnormality that occurs during fetal development.

The absence of the carotid artery can have potential complications. The other arteries in the neck, such as the vertebral and subclavian arteries, may compensate for the lack of blood flow, but this compensation may not always be sufficient. This compensatory mechanism can lead to collateral vessel formation, which may be associated with additional congenital vascular malformations.

Comprehensive medical evaluation and diagnostic imaging are necessary to confirm the absence of the carotid artery and identify any associated congenital vascular malformations. This information is crucial for understanding the extent of the condition and developing an appropriate management plan.

Cardiovascular Implications of Carotid Artery Agenesis

The absence of a carotid artery can have significant cardiovascular implications. Carotid artery agenesis refers to the absence or non-development of the carotid artery, an essential blood vessel that supplies oxygenated blood to the head and neck. This rare condition can result in several cardiovascular abnormalities, including altered blood flow, impaired blood pressure regulation, and an increased risk of developing congenital heart defects.

Effects on Blood Flow

In individuals with carotid artery agenesis, the absence of this major artery can lead to changes in blood flow patterns within the head and neck. The blood supply may be compensated through collateral circulation, where other blood vessels take over the role of the carotid artery. This adaptive mechanism helps maintain essential oxygen and nutrient supply to the brain and surrounding structures, but it can result in altered flow dynamics and increased risk of complications.

Impaired Blood Pressure Regulation

The carotid artery plays a crucial role in regulating blood pressure. It contains specialized sensors called baroreceptors that detect changes in blood pressure and send signals to the brain to adjust vascular tone and heart rate accordingly. In individuals with carotid artery agenesis, the absence of these baroreceptors can disrupt the normal blood pressure regulatory mechanisms, potentially leading to fluctuations in blood pressure and increased cardiovascular risk.

Development of Congenital Heart Defects

Carotid artery agenesis is often associated with other congenital vascular malformations, such as abnormalities in the aortic arch or other major blood vessels. These structural anomalies can impact the normal development of the heart, leading to the formation of congenital heart defects. The specific type and severity of the defect can vary from person to person, further highlighting the need for comprehensive medical evaluation and management for individuals with carotid artery agenesis.

Diagnosis

The diagnosis of carotid artery agenesis involves a comprehensive evaluation and the use of diagnostic tests and imaging techniques. These assessments aim to confirm the absence of the carotid artery, assess the presence of associated vascular anomalies, and determine the overall impact on cardiovascular health.

Diagnostic tests and imaging techniques that may be employed include:

  1. Magnetic resonance angiography (MRA): This non-invasive imaging technique produces detailed images of blood vessels, helping identify the absence of the carotid artery and associated vascular anomalies.
  2. Computed tomography angiography (CTA): CTA combines computed tomography (CT) scanning with contrast material to visualize blood vessels and detect abnormalities.
  3. Doppler ultrasound: This test uses sound waves to evaluate blood flow in the arteries and can aid in identifying abnormalities or reduced blood flow in the absence of the carotid artery.
  4. Cardiac catheterization: In some cases, cardiac catheterization may be performed to directly visualize the blood flow through the arteries and assess cardiovascular function.
Diagnostic Test/Imaging Technique Advantages Disadvantages
Magnetic resonance angiography (MRA) Non-invasive, produces detailed images Can be contraindicated for individuals with certain medical conditions, limited availability in some regions
Computed tomography angiography (CTA) Provides detailed images, relatively quick procedure Exposure to ionizing radiation, use of contrast material may have risks for some individuals
Doppler ultrasound Non-invasive, doesn’t expose to radiation May have limited visibility in certain areas of the body
Cardiac catheterization Direct visualization of blood flow and cardiovascular function Invasive procedure, carries some risks

Treatment Options and Management

While carotid artery agenesis cannot be reversed, it can be managed to minimize the impact on a person’s health. Various treatment options are available, including:

  1. Medications: Medications can be prescribed to control blood pressure and prevent complications associated with carotid artery agenesis. These medications may include beta-blockers, calcium channel blockers, or angiotensin-converting enzyme (ACE) inhibitors.
  2. Surgical Interventions: In some cases, surgical interventions may be necessary to address associated vascular anomalies. These procedures aim to improve blood flow and reduce the risk of complications. Examples of surgical interventions include vascular bypass surgery or stenting procedures.
  3. Lifestyle Modifications: Making certain lifestyle modifications can also help manage carotid artery agenesis and improve cardiovascular health. These modifications may include adopting a heart-healthy diet, engaging in regular physical activity, managing stress levels, avoiding tobacco and excessive alcohol consumption, and maintaining a healthy weight.

Each treatment option and management strategy should be tailored to the individual’s specific condition and overall health. It is important for individuals with carotid artery agenesis to consult with a healthcare professional for a comprehensive evaluation and personalized treatment plan.

Congenital Vascular Malformations

Individuals with carotid artery agenesis may experience congenital vascular malformations, which refer to abnormalities in the development of blood vessels. These malformations can affect various areas of the body, including the brain, neck, and face. Some common congenital vascular malformations that may co-exist with carotid artery agenesis include:

  • Arteriovenous malformations (AVMs): Abnormal connections between arteries and veins that disrupt normal blood flow.
  • Hemangiomas: Growth of abnormal blood vessels that form a benign tumor.
  • Aneurysms: Weakening and bulging of blood vessel walls, which can potentially rupture.
  • Vascular tumors: Abnormal growths in blood vessels.

The presence of these congenital vascular malformations can further increase the risk of complications, including neurological symptoms and potential disruptions in blood flow.
